#281ec2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#281ec2 is composed of 15.7% red, 11.8%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.4% cyan, 84.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 243.7 degrees, a saturation of 73.2% and a lightness of 43.9%. #281ec2 color hex could be obtained by blending #503cff with #000085.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#281ec2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#281ec2 has RGB values of R:40, G:30,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0.85,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 2629314.
